Remove PDF Map Object Entries (QPQRPME) API


  Required Parameter Group:

1 Number of entries removed Output Binary(4)
2 Entries removed Output Char(*)
3 Length of entries removed Input Binary(4)
4 Entry lengths and entry offsets Output Array(*) of Char(8)
5 Length of entry lengths and offsets Input Binary(4)
6 Qualified PDF Map object name Input Char(20)
7 Maximum number of entries Input Binary(4)
8 Remove criteria Input Char(*)
9 Error code I/O Char(*)

  Default Public Authority: *USE

  Threadsafe: Yes

The Remove PDF Map object Entries (QPQRPME) API removes one or more PDF Map object entries that match the values specified on the remove criteria parameter. It returns the number of entries that were removed and, optionally, returns the actual PDF map entries removed.


Authorities and Locks

PDF Map object Library Authority
*EXECUTE
PDF Map object Authority
*CHANGE
PDF Map object Lock
*SHRUPD

Required Parameter Group

Number of entries removed
OUTPUT; BINARY(4)

The number of PDF map entries, satisfying the values specified on the remove criteria parameter, that were successfully removed from the PDF Map object. If this field is 0, no entries satisfied the remove criteria. This value can never be greater than the maximum number of entries parameter.

Entries removed
OUTPUT; CHAR(*)

The actual entries removed. All entries that satisfied the remove criteria parameter and were removed (up to the maximum number of entries parameter) are returned if sufficient space is provided. The API returns only the data that the area can hold.

If you do not want the entries that were removed to be returned in this parameter, specify 0 for the length of entries removed parameter.

Every entry removed causes the number of entries removed parameter to be incremented by 1.

The format of this parameter is the same as the Remove criteria parameter. Refer to Remove Criteria Format for the layout of this parameter.

Length of entries removed
INPUT; BINARY(4)

The length of the entries removed parameter. If this length is larger than the actual size of the entries removed parameter, the results may not be predictable. The minimum length is 0 or >= (greater than or equal to) 8 bytes. If 0 is used, the entries removed from the PDF Map are not returned and the bytes returned and the bytes available in the entries removed parameter are not set.

Entry lengths and entry offsets
OUTPUT; ARRAY of CHAR(8)

A data structure that contains entry lengths and entry offsets for all entries that were found that met the remove criteria parameter. An entry length and entry offset exist for every entry returned in the entries removed parameter. These entry lengths and entry offsets are used to parse through the entries removed parameter. If the length of entries removed parameter is 0, this information will not be returned.

The size of the entry lengths and entry offsets parameter should be at least:

 8 + (the maximum number of entries parameter * 8)

You must provide enough space in both the entries removed and the entry lengths and offset parameter for this API to return complete information to you.

See Format for Entry Lengths and Entry Offsets for details on the data structure.

Length of entry lengths and entry offsets
INPUT; BINARY(4)

The length of the entry lengths and entry offsets. If the length is longer than the entry lengths and entry offsets parameter, the results may not be predictable. The minimum length is 8. If the length of entries removed parameter is 0, which means you do not want the entries removed to be returned, this parameter is ignored.

Qualified PDF Map object name
INPUT; CHAR(20)

The PDF Map object from which you want to remove entries, and the library in which it is located. The first 10 characters contain the PDF Map object name, and the second 10 characters contain the library name.

You can use these special values for the library name:

*CURLIB The job's current library
*LIBL The library list

Maximum number of entries
INPUT; BINARY(4)

The maximum number of PDF Map object entries to be removed that satisfy the remove criteria. Valid values are 1 through 4095.

Remove criteria
INPUT; CHAR(*)

The criteria used to find matches in the PDF Map object.

Refer to Remove Criteria Format for details on the format.

Error code
I/O; CHAR(*)

The structure in which to return error information. For the format of the structure, see Error code parameter.


Format for Entry Lengths and Entry Offsets

The following information is returned in the entry lengths and entry offsets parameter. This information is needed to parse through the entries removed parameter. For detailed descriptions of the fields in the table, see Field Descriptions.

Offset Type Field
Dec Hex
0 0 BINARY(4) Bytes returned
4 4 BINARY(4) Bytes available
Note: The following fields will be repeated. The number of times they are repeated depends on the length of the entry lengths and entry offsets parameter and the number of entries actually removed.
    BINARY(4) Entry offset
    BINARY(4) Entry length


Remove Criteria Format

The following information is the format of the remove criteria. The same format is also used for what is returned in the Entries removed parameter. For more details about the fields in the following table, see Field Descriptions.

Offset Type Field
Dec Hex
0 0 BINARY(4) Sequence number
14 E CHAR(10) Output queue name
24 18 CHAR(10) Output queue library name
34 22 CHAR(10) Spooled file name
44 2C CHAR(10) Job name
54 36 CHAR(10) User name
64 40 CHAR(10) User data
74 4A CHAR(10) Form type
84 54 CHAR(250) Mail tag


Field Descriptions

Bytes available. The length of all data available to return. All available data is returned if enough space is provided.

Bytes returned. The length of the data actually returned.

Entry length. The length of the entry removed from the PDF Map object. Valid values are 1-2000, depending on how the PDF Map object was created.

Entry offset. The number of bytes from the beginning of the immediately preceding entry to the first byte of the entry returned. For the first entry, the offset is the number of bytes from the beginning of the parameter to the first byte of the first entry.

Form type. The type of forms that should be loaded on the printer before this spooled file is printed or spooled files whose form type matches this value are included in the list. This field can be used in conjunction with any of the other values in the Remove criteria format to select a list of entries to remove.

The following special values can be used for the form type:

*ALL Map entries are removed regardless of the value for form type.

Job name. The name of the job that created the spooled file. This field can be used in conjunction with any of the other values in the Remove criteria format to select a list of entries to remove.

The following special values can be used for the job name:

*ALL Map entries are removed regardless of the value for job name.

Mail tag. The value of the mail tag for a spooled file or a spooled file segment. This field can be used in conjunction with any of the other values in the Remove criteria format to select a list of entries to remove.

The following special values can be used for mail tag:

*ALL Map entries are removed regardless of the value for mail tag.

Output queue library name. The name of the library where the output queue resides.

The following special values can be used for the output queue library name:

*CURLIB The current library for the current job.
*LIBL The library list of the current job.

Output queue name. The name of the output queue in which the spooled file is located. At least one output queue or special value must be specified. This field can be used in conjunction with any of the other values in the Remove criteria format to select a list of entries to remove.

The following special values can be used for the output queue name:

*ALL Map entries are removed regardless of the value for output queue name.

Sequence number. The user-defined sequence number for an entry.

X'00000000' All entries will be examined. If an entry is non-segmented and it matches the remove criteria, then it is removed. If an entry is segmented, only those segments that match the remove criteria will be removed.
sequence-number The sequence number of an entry. A single entry will be examined. If the entry is non-segmented and it matches the remove criteria, then it is removed. If an entry is segmented, only segments that match the remove criteria will be removed.

This field can be used in conjunction with any of the other values in the Remove criteria format to select a list of entries to remove.

Spooled file name. The name of the spooled file. At least one output queue or special value must be specified. This field can be used in conjunction with any of the other values in the Remove criteria format to select a list of entries to remove.

The following special value is used for the output queue name:

*ALL Map entries are removed regardless of the spooled file name.

User data. The value of the user data. At least one user name or special value must be specified. This field can be used in conjunction with any of the other values in the Remove criteria format to select a list of entries to remove.

The following special value is used for the user data:

*ALL Map entries are removed regardless of the user data.

User name. The name of the user that created the spooled file. At least one user name or special value must be specified. This field can be used in conjunction with any of the other values in the Remove criteria format to select a list of entries to remove.

The following special value is used for the output queue name:

*ALL Map entries are removed regardless of the user name.

Error Messages

Message ID Error Message Text
CPF3CF1 E Error code parameter not valid.
CPF3C70 E Length of entries removed parameter is not valid.
CPF3C76 E Length of lengths and offsets of entries &1 is not valid.
CPF3C79 E Maximum number of entries &1 is not valid.
CPD5F01 D API &5 detected an internal system failure.
CPF9801 E Object &2 in library &3 not found.
CPF9802 E Not authorized to object &2 in &3.
CPF9810 E Library &1 not found.
CPF9820 E Not authorized to use library &1.
CPF9872 E Program or service program &1 in library &2 ended. Reason code &3.
